The salt vs chlorine pool maintenance cost favors traditional chlorine on equipment exposure, while salt shifts spending toward electricity, salt, and eventual cell replacement. Salt doesn’t remove chlorine from the equation because its generator makes chlorine from dissolved salt. In San Diego, the useful comparison starts with ongoing upkeep, not the separate conversion bill.

This is about upkeep, not conversion

Upkeep begins after the chlorination system is already operating. That distinction matters because conversion can overshadow several years of routine spending.

Angi’s May 2026 San Diego guide puts a saltwater conversion at $750 to $1,750. It identifies the generator as the largest line item, at $500 to $2,000, with labor at $100 to $200. Those figures matter when you’re deciding whether to convert. They aren’t recurring maintenance costs.

Once installed, both systems need water testing and chemical adjustment. A salt pool isn’t chlorine-free or self-managing. Its cell uses electricity to turn dissolved salt into chlorine. A traditional pool gets chlorine through tablets, liquid, or another directly added product.

The CDC’s healthy swimming guidance recommends keeping pool pH between 7.0 and 7.8. It also calls for at least 1 ppm free chlorine, or at least 2 ppm when cyanuric acid or stabilized chlorine is used. The CDC recommends testing chlorine and pH at least twice daily, with more testing during heavy use. DPD kits are more accurate than strips.

Those chemistry goals don’t change with the delivery method. Our salt water conversion and service guide explains where the generator fits. For this comparison, assume that equipment is already installed and working.

Annual chemical cost

Traditional chlorine has the smaller system-specific annual cost in the published figures. HomeGuide’s September 2025 maintenance guide lists chlorine alone at $55 to $130 per year. That isn’t a complete pool budget. Balancing chemicals, cleaning, electricity, water, and repairs sit outside that line.

HomeGuide also lists annual chemical spending by pool surface. Its figures are about $175 for fiberglass, $400 for vinyl, and $750 for concrete. Surface type matters because each finish interacts differently with water chemistry and treatment.

Salt systems replace direct chlorine purchases with several different expenses. Angi’s May 2026 guide puts annual salt refills at $150 to $400. It also estimates that running the generator adds roughly $35 to $50 per month in electricity. HomeGuide’s September 2025 guide lists DIY saltwater upkeep at about $45 per month.

Pool volume moves the salt bill. Angi estimates roughly 200 pounds of pool-grade salt per 10,000 gallons. Its cited 40-pound bag range is $20 to $55. HomeGuide lists a 40-pound bag near $50. Confirm the current shelf price and your cell manufacturer’s salt instructions before buying.

The cost salt pools don’t advertise: cell replacement

The salt cell is the expense most likely to change a long-term comparison. It works in a harsh environment, carrying electrical current through mineral-rich pool water while producing chlorine.

Angi’s May 2026 guide puts salt cell replacement at $700 to $1,100. A failed control board adds another possible equipment expense. Angi lists that repair at $500 to $900. Those aren’t annual charges, but they can land as a large single bill.

INYO Pools says a salt cell can last five years or longer when the pool and equipment are maintained properly. That is an industry retailer’s estimate, not a guaranteed lifespan. Water balance, cell cleaning, output settings, and operating conditions affect what happens at a specific pool.

Mineral scale can coat the cell plates and interfere with chlorine production. HomeGuide’s September 2025 guide says salt cells need a mild acid wash every three to four months unless the unit is self-cleaning. Cleaning too casually can damage the cell, so follow its manual and have the equipment inspected when output drops.

Low chlorine doesn’t automatically mean the cell is dead. Water balance, sunlight, swimmer waste, dirty equipment, or control settings can create the same symptom. The salt cell troubleshooting guide covers the signs that separate a chemistry problem from equipment failure.

Five-year salt vs chlorine pool maintenance cost

A five-year view exposes the difference between small recurring purchases and equipment risk. The cleanest calculation uses only system-specific costs, holding the cited figures constant.

HomeGuide’s September 2025 chlorine range is $55 to $130 per year. Multiplied by five, that becomes $275 to $650 for chlorine alone. It doesn’t include balancing chemicals, routine service, pump electricity, water, or repairs.

For salt, Angi’s May 2026 annual refill range of $150 to $400 becomes $750 to $2,000 over five years. Its added generator electricity estimate is $35 to $50 monthly. Multiplied by 60 months, that becomes $2,100 to $3,000.

Together, those two salt-specific lines total $2,850 to $5,000 across five years. That subtotal excludes conversion, balancing chemicals, professional service, and equipment repairs.

A cell replacement may fall outside that window. If one occurs within it, adding Angi’s $700 to $1,100 range produces a planning total of $3,550 to $6,100. A control board problem would be separate.

This isn’t a complete ownership budget for either pool. It isolates the expenses created by each sanitizing method. Both pools still need circulation, filtration, cleaning, chemistry management, and occasional repairs. Salt offers automated chlorine production, but that convenience comes with electricity use and equipment exposure.

What actually drives the difference

Pool size, sunlight, swimmers, surface material, and equipment condition drive the real gap. The chlorination method is only one part of the bill.

Volume comes first. Angi’s May 2026 guide says a 10-by-20-foot inground pool averages 10,000 to 15,000 gallons. A 20-by-40-foot pool can hold twice that or more. More water means more salt for a salt system and more treatment product for direct chlorination.

Sun and swimmer load change chlorine demand. The CDC says sunlight, sweat, dirt, urine, fecal matter, and droplet-producing jets reduce chlorine levels. An exposed Santee pool can behave differently from a Point Loma pool that spends mornings under the marine layer. A crowded weekend adds another variable.

Water balance also affects equipment. The CDC warns that chlorine kills germs more slowly above pH 7.8. Water below pH 7.0 can corrode pipes and equipment. Salt systems add a cell that depends on stable water and clean plates, but traditional pools aren’t protected from poor chemistry.

Draining creates a local cost wrinkle. Inside City of San Diego limits, Municipal Code sections 43.0304 and 43.035(e)(3) prohibit saline pool water from entering gutters or storm drains. A narrow exception applies when prepared water travels through a pipe or concrete channel directly to a naturally saline water body. Other cities set their own stormwater rules.

Water prices also vary across the county. The San Diego County Water Authority identifies 22 retail member agencies serving the region. Confirm rates with your water provider and discharge rules with your city before planning a drain.

What weekly service includes either way

Good weekly care handles the same core needs for both systems. The water needs testing, surfaces need brushing, debris needs removal, baskets need emptying, and circulation equipment needs inspection.

The main difference is how the sanitizer reaches the water. A chlorine pool needs direct product additions. A salt pool needs cell output checks, salt management, and periodic inspection for scale. Neither system eliminates pH adjustment, filtration, or physical cleaning.

HomeGuide’s September 2025 guide puts weekly or biweekly pool service at $80 to $150 per month. Its weekly pricing averages $20 to $50 per visit, depending on the workload. The same guide lists a professional saltwater package at $80 to $95 per month for one visit. Those figures aren’t directly interchangeable because visit frequency and included tasks can differ.

Tablet users should also track stabilizer buildup. Stabilized chlorine adds cyanuric acid over time, and excess buildup can make water management harder. Read the local guide to chlorine tablets for San Diego pools before choosing a dosing routine.

Routine cleaning isn’t the same as construction work. When a pro touches equipment or structure, ask for the license number and confirm it through the California Contractors State License Board.

Frequently asked questions

Is a saltwater pool cheaper to maintain than a chlorine pool?

Not necessarily. Salt systems add generator electricity, salt refills, and eventual cell replacement. Traditional chlorine avoids that equipment but requires purchased chlorine.

Does a saltwater pool still use chlorine?

Yes. The salt cell converts dissolved salt into chlorine, so both systems sanitize with chlorine.

How long does a salt cell last?

INYO Pools says a maintained salt cell can last five years or longer. That is an industry estimate, not a promise for every cell.

Can salt pool water enter a San Diego storm drain?

Inside City of San Diego limits, Municipal Code sections 43.0304 and 43.035(e)(3) prohibit saline pool water from entering gutters or storm drains, apart from a narrow direct-discharge exception.
